Types Of Audio Splitters

Audio splitters help share sound from one device to multiple outputs. They come in different types for various connections and uses.

Choosing the right splitter depends on the audio source and the devices you want to connect.

3.5mm Jack Splitters

These splitters use the common 3.5mm headphone jack. They split audio signals for headphones or speakers. You can connect two or more devices to one audio source.

  • Simple and widely used
  • Supports stereo sound
  • Great for sharing music on phones or laptops
  • Usually small and portable

Rca Splitters

RCA splitters work with red and white connectors for audio. They split left and right audio channels. These splitters are common in home theater systems and older audio devices.

FeatureDetails
ConnectorsRed and White RCA plugs
UseStereo audio splitting
Common DevicesDVD players, speakers, stereo receivers
Audio QualityGood for analog sound

Optical And Hdmi Splitters

Optical splitters use fiber optic cables to send digital audio signals. HDMI splitters carry both audio and video signals. These splitters keep high sound quality and support surround sound systems.

  • Optical splitters for pure digital audio
  • HDMI splitters for audio and video
  • Used in home theaters and gaming setups
  • Support multiple output devices

Usb Audio Splitters

USB audio splitters let you connect several USB audio devices to one computer. They work well for microphones, headphones, and speakers. These splitters often include extra USB ports for other devices.

TypePurposeTypical Use
USB Hub with AudioConnect multiple USB audio devicesPodcasting, gaming, conferencing
USB to 3.5mm SplitterConvert USB audio to headphone jackHeadphone sharing on computers

Choosing The Right Splitter

Using an audio splitter helps you share sound from one source to many devices. Picking the right splitter makes sure your audio stays clear and works well.

Consider your devices, how many outputs you need, the build quality, and your budget before buying an audio splitter.

Compatibility With Devices

Check if the splitter fits your device’s audio jack. Most splitters use 3.5mm plugs, but some need RCA or other types. Also, confirm if your device supports audio output through the port.

Number Of Outputs Needed

  • Decide how many headphones or speakers you want to connect.
  • Choose a splitter with enough output ports for all devices.
  • Remember that more outputs may reduce audio quality.
  • Check if the splitter supports both stereo and mono outputs.

Quality And Build

FeatureWhat to Look For
MaterialDurable plastic or metal casing
Cable LengthLong enough for your setup
Connector TypeGold-plated connectors for better sound
Noise ReductionShielded cables to avoid interference

Budget Considerations

Set a budget but avoid very cheap splitters. Low-cost options may break fast or cause sound loss. Spending a little more usually gives better results.

Here are budget tips:

  1. List your needs before shopping.
  2. Check online reviews for reliability.
  3. Buy from trusted brands or stores.

Setting Up Audio Splitters

Audio splitters let you share sound from one device to many outputs. They are useful in many settings, like parties or classrooms.

Setting up splitters correctly helps keep sound quality clear. Follow these tips for best results.

Connecting To Source Devices

Start by plugging the splitter into your source device, such as a phone or computer. Use the right cable type, like 3.5mm jack or RCA, based on your device.

Make sure connections are tight to avoid loose signals. Check if your device supports output to multiple devices before connecting.

Linking Multiple Headphones Or Speakers

You can connect many headphones or speakers to one splitter. Each output jack on the splitter sends audio to a separate device.

  • Use headphones with matching plugs for best fit
  • Do not exceed the splitter’s maximum output devices
  • Check volume levels on each device to avoid distortion
  • Test each connected device before use

Avoiding Signal Loss

Signal loss happens when audio gets weaker or unclear. To avoid this, use quality splitters and short cables.

CauseSolution
Long cablesUse shorter cables
Cheap splitterBuy a good quality splitter
Too many devicesLimit the number of connected devices
Loose connectionsCheck and secure all plugs

Using Amplifiers With Splitters

Amplifiers help keep sound strong when many devices connect. Place the amplifier after the splitter to boost the signal.

Remember these tips when using amplifiers:

  • Choose an amplifier that matches your splitter’s output
  • Connect the amplifier before or after speakers based on your setup
  • Keep volume moderate to avoid distortion
  • Check power supply for the amplifier

Tips For Optimal Sound Quality

Using an audio splitter can let you share sound with many devices. To enjoy clear sound, follow some simple tips. These tips help keep your music or audio clear and strong.

Good sound depends on many small details. Paying attention to cables and connections can make a big difference.

Using High-quality Cables

Choose cables made with good materials. Copper cables usually carry sound better. Cheap cables can cause noise or weak sound.

  • Look for cables with thick wires and good shielding
  • Avoid very long cables to reduce signal loss
  • Use cables with strong connectors that fit well
  • Replace damaged or old cables quickly

Keeping Connections Secure

Loose connections cause sound problems like crackling or loss. Make sure plugs fit tightly into ports. Check all connections before use.

Try these tips to keep connections secure:

  1. Push plugs fully into jacks until you feel a click or resistance.
  2. Use cable ties or clips to prevent cables from moving.
  3. Keep cables away from areas where they might be pulled or bent.
  4. Clean connectors if you see dust or dirt.

Minimizing Interference

Interference can cause static and noise. Keep cables away from power cords, wireless devices, and other electronics. This reduces unwanted sounds.

Source of InterferenceHow to Avoid
Power cablesKeep audio cables at least 6 inches apart
Wi-Fi routersPlace splitters and cables far from routers
Fluorescent lightsTurn off lights or move cables away

Adjusting Volume Levels

Set volume levels carefully. Too high volume can cause distortion. Too low volume reduces clarity. Balance volume on each device for best sound.

  • Start with low volume on the main source
  • Increase volume gradually on each connected device
  • Avoid maxing out volume to prevent noise
  • Use volume controls on each device for fine tuning

Troubleshooting Common Issues

Audio splitters help share sound from one device to many. Sometimes, users face issues using them. This guide covers common problems and how to fix them.

Follow these tips to improve your audio splitter experience and solve issues quickly.

Distorted Or Weak Sound

Distorted or weak sound often happens if cables are loose or damaged. Check all connections and replace faulty cables.

  • Make sure all plugs fit tightly in the ports
  • Use high-quality cables for better sound
  • Avoid bending or twisting cables sharply
  • Check the volume settings on all connected devices
  • Try using a different audio splitter to rule out hardware problems

No Audio Output

No sound can be due to power issues or wrong connections. Confirm the audio source is working and that the splitter gets power if needed.

CauseFix
Loose cablesPush cables firmly into ports
Muted deviceUnmute or raise volume
Splitter needs powerPlug in power adapter
Wrong input/outputCheck device settings

Compatibility Problems

Not all audio splitters work with every device. Some devices may need specific adapters or settings.

Try these fixes if you face compatibility issues:

  • Check device manuals for supported audio types
  • Use adapters for different plug sizes
  • Update device firmware or drivers
  • Test the splitter with another device

Signal Delay Or Echo

Signal delay or echo can happen if the audio path is too long or the splitter is low quality. Reduce cable length or try a better splitter.

  1. Use shorter cables between devices
  2. Place devices closer to each other
  3. Choose splitters with good reviews for low delay
  4. Check audio settings for echo cancellation

Advanced Uses For Audio Splitters

Audio splitters are simple tools to share one audio signal with many devices. Beyond basic use, they help in complex audio setups.

This guide explains advanced ways to use audio splitters for better sound control and flexibility.

Recording Multiple Audio Channels

Audio splitters let you record the same sound on many devices at once. This helps capture different audio channels from one source.

It is useful for podcasts, interviews, and live recordings where multiple devices must record audio simultaneously.

  • Connect splitter to the microphone output
  • Send signals to several recorders
  • Ensure each recorder is set to the correct channel

Live Sound Applications

In live shows, audio splitters send sound to speakers, monitors, and recording gear at the same time. This keeps sound consistent everywhere.

Splitters help avoid extra cables and reduce signal loss in large venues.

  • Send output to main speakers and stage monitors
  • Feed audio to recording equipment
  • Use quality splitters to keep sound clear

Integrating With Audio Mixers

Audio splitters connect many devices to an audio mixer. This allows mixing sounds from different sources easily.

Splitters send signals from instruments or microphones to several mixer channels for better control.

  • Split instrument output to mixer and amplifier
  • Send microphone signals to multiple mixer inputs
  • Adjust each channel for balanced sound

Wireless Audio Splitting Options

Wireless audio splitters send sound signals without cables. They work with Bluetooth or Wi-Fi devices.

This allows more freedom in sound setups and reduces cable clutter on stage or in studios.

  • Pair wireless splitter with Bluetooth headphones
  • Use Wi-Fi splitters for multi-room audio
  • Check battery life and signal range for best use

Frequently Asked Questions

What Is An Audio Splitter And How Does It Work?

An audio splitter divides one audio output into multiple outputs. It allows multiple headphones or speakers to connect to one device. This helps share music or audio without losing sound quality. Splitters are simple and useful for group listening.

Can Audio Splitters Support Different Headphone Types?

Yes, many audio splitters support various headphone types. Most splitters work with standard 3. 5mm headphone jacks. Some models also support USB or Bluetooth connections. Always check compatibility before buying an audio splitter for different devices.

How To Choose The Best Audio Splitter For Your Needs?

Consider the number of outputs needed and device compatibility. Look for quality materials to ensure clear sound. Check if the splitter supports stereo or mono audio. Reading reviews helps identify reliable and durable splitters.

Will Using An Audio Splitter Reduce Sound Quality?

A good quality audio splitter minimally affects sound quality. Cheap or faulty splitters may cause audio loss or distortion. Always choose high-grade splitters to maintain clear and balanced audio for all connected devices.
